Medication Risks and Interactions in November 2025: Aspirin, Antivirals, Diuretics, and More

When you take medication interactions, how one drug changes how another works in your body. Also known as drug-drug interactions, they’re not just fine print—they’re real risks that can send you to the ER. In November 2025, our most-read articles dug into exactly these hidden dangers: from aspirin making blood thinners deadly, to smoking quietly weakening your prescriptions.

Aspirin and blood thinners, a common combo for heart patients nearly doubles bleeding risk—yet many don’t know it. Antiviral interactions, especially with CYP3A4 and P-glycoprotein, can make your treatment fail or turn toxic. And diuretics, water pills often prescribed for high blood pressure, aren’t harmless—they can drain your electrolytes if you don’t balance fluids right. These aren’t edge cases. They’re everyday problems for millions.

It’s not just about what’s in the pill. Inactive ingredients, the fillers and dyes in generic drugs can cause reactions when stacked. Anticholinergic medications, like Benadryl and overactive bladder drugs, quietly raise dementia risk after years of use. Even your expiration dates, when pills lose potency, matter more than you think—some expired meds are safe, others are risky. And if you’re on opioids, your nausea meds might be doing more harm than good.

What ties all these together? Your body’s chemistry isn’t static. It’s a living system. Smoking changes how your liver breaks down drugs. Kidney decline alters how long meds stay in your blood. Stress flips your gut-brain signals and triggers IBS. Even flying can wreck your ears if you don’t know how to equalize pressure. These aren’t random topics—they’re pieces of one big puzzle: how your body reacts to what you put in it.

Smoking and Medications: How Cigarettes Alter Drug Levels in Your Body

Smoking and Medications: How Cigarettes Alter Drug Levels in Your Body

Smoking changes how your body processes medications, especially those broken down by the CYP1A2 enzyme. This can lead to reduced effectiveness while smoking and dangerous toxicity after quitting. Learn which drugs are affected and how to stay safe.
